首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

js扩展文件的Angular routing 404 (asp.net核心IIS暴露物理目录的详细错误)

Angular routing 404是指在使用Angular框架进行前端开发时,页面路由出现404错误的情况。该错误通常出现在使用Angular的路由功能时,无法找到对应的路由路径。

Angular是一个流行的前端开发框架,它提供了一套完整的工具和组件,用于构建现代化的Web应用程序。Angular的路由功能允许开发者根据URL路径来加载不同的组件和页面,以实现单页应用(SPA)的效果。

当出现Angular routing 404错误时,可能有以下原因导致:

  1. 路由路径未定义:检查代码中的路由定义,确保URL路径在路由配置中有对应的定义。
  2. 路由模块未加载:确保在主模块中正确导入并配置了路由模块。
  3. 路由导航错误:检查代码中的路由导航逻辑,确保导航到正确的路由路径。

解决Angular routing 404错误的方法包括:

  1. 检查路由配置:确保在Angular的路由配置文件(通常是app-routing.module.ts)中定义了正确的路由路径,并且将对应的组件与路由路径进行关联。
  2. 检查导航逻辑:确保在代码中正确使用路由导航功能,例如使用routerLink指令或通过编程方式进行导航。
  3. 检查服务器配置:如果应用程序部署在IIS上,确保IIS服务器已经正确配置并暴露了应用程序的物理目录。
  4. 检查文件扩展名配置:确保服务器已正确配置以支持Angular的路由功能,例如在IIS中,需要将.js扩展名添加到静态文件扩展名列表中。

在腾讯云的产品生态系统中,有一些相关的产品可以与Angular配合使用,以加强应用程序的性能和安全性:

  1. 腾讯云CDN:通过腾讯云的CDN加速服务,可以将应用程序的静态资源分发到全球各地的节点,提高页面加载速度和用户访问体验。产品链接:腾讯云CDN
  2. 腾讯云云服务器(CVM):作为一种云计算基础设施服务,腾讯云的云服务器可以提供可扩展的计算资源,用于部署和运行Angular应用程序。产品链接:腾讯云云服务器

以上是关于Angular routing 404错误的解释和解决方法,以及与之配合使用的腾讯云产品推荐。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券